Funny but True -- What happens after the Wedding



Dear Tech Support,

Last year I upgraded  from Boyfriend 5.0 to Husband 1.0 and noticed a distinct slow down in overall  system performance --particularly in the flower and jewelry applications,  which operated flawlessly under
Boyfriend 5.0.
  
In addition, Husband 1.0  uninstalled many other valuable programs,such as Romance 9.5 and Personal  Attention 6.5 and then installed undesirable programs such as NFL 5.0, NBA 3.0, and Golf Clubs 4.1.

Conversation 8.0 no longer runs, and Housecleaning  2.6 simply crashes the system. I've tried running Nagging 5.3 to fix these  problems, but to no avail. 
 
What can I do?
 
Signed,  Desperate
-------------------------------------------------------------
 
Dear  Desperate:

First keep in mind, Boyfriend 5.0 is an Entertainment  Package, while Husband 1.0 is an Operating System

Please enter the command:  "http: I Thought You Loved Me.html" and try to download Tears 6.2 and don't forget to install the Guilt 3.0 update. If that application works as designed, Husband 1.0 should then automatically run the applications Jewelry 2.0 and Flowers 3.5.

But remember, overuse of the above application can cause  Husband 1.0 default to Grumpy Silence 2.5, Happy Hour 7.0 or Beer 6.1. 
Beer 6.1 is a very bad program that will download the Snoring Loudly Beta.
Whatever you do, DO NOT install Mother-in-law 1.0 
(it runs a virus in the background that will eventually seize control of all your system resources). 
Also, do not attempt to reinstall the Boyfriend 5.0 program.These  are unsupported applications and will crash Husband 1.0.


In summary,  Husband 1.0 is a great program, but it does have limited memory and cannot  learn new applications quickly. 
You might consider buying additional software  to improve memory and performance. 
We  recommend Food 3.0 and Hot Lingerie  7.7.

Good Luck, Tech Support
